A HISTORIC RACE
The inaugural race is five days away, and we are super excited to welcome you and runners from around the world!
Organizing the race has been a rewarding and sometimes hectic process. We have been overwhelmed with the international interest and support, even though we’ve known all along that we are creating something special.
Over the last couple of months we have experienced a growing interest in running in Palestine. More and more runners have joined our weekly training runs - and quite a few will run their first 5k or 10k on race day. Something that most of us take for granted, give Palestinians a renewed sense of freedom and identity.
All in all, Sunday is going to be a historic day. It will be the culmination of a lot of hard work, and a new lifestyle, for local runners in training, who will hopefully inspire many others to join in on the movement.

SECURITY
A note on our security following the situation in Boston
We are deeply saddened by the news from Boston. It is a sad day for athletes all over the world. Our security plan for Palestine Marathon is in place and has been developed in close cooperation with police and authorities, whom we contacted immediately following the news, and we remain in close contact in the next days leading up to our race on Sunday.
As a big city sports event we take our athletes’ and spectators’ security very seriously. Palestinian police is handling road safety on race day.
